#4b3eaa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4b3eaa is composed of 29.4% red, 24.3% green and 66.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.9% cyan, 63.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 33.3% black. It has a hue angle of 247.2 degrees, a saturation of 46.6% and a lightness of 45.5%. #4b3eaa color hex could be obtained by blending #967cff with #000055.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#4b3eaa color description : Dark moderate blue.

#4b3eaa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4b3eaa has RGB values of R:75, G:62, B:170 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0.64, Y:0,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 4931242.

Shades and Tints of #4b3eaa

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05040c is the darkest color, while #fdf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4b3eaa

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#747474 is the less saturated color, while #2208e0 is the most saturated one.
